A traditional wood-burning fireplace is classic and timeless, providing both warmth and a rustic aesthetic appeal. However, if you’re concerned about environmental impact or maintenance, consider switching to gas or electric fireplaces. These alternatives offer similar benefits without the need for chopping wood or cleaning up ash.
For those seeking a modern take on the traditional hearth, linear fireplaces are gaining popularity due to their sleek design. These elongated fireplaces can be installed at eye level, creating an impressive focal point in any room. Bioethanol fireplaces are another contemporary option that burns clean fuel and doesn’t require venting – perfect for urban dwellings where space may be limited.
If you wish to maintain the charm of an open flame but crave something unique, consider installing a double-sided fireplace. This style allows you to enjoy its warmth from two different rooms simultaneously – making it not just a heating element but also an architectural feature in your home.
The mantel is another aspect of your fireplace that can dramatically alter its overall look. A wooden mantel offers a warm farmhouse feel while marble lends itself towards elegance and sophistication. For those who prefer minimalism, floating mantels made from metal or glass add sleekness without overpowering other design elements in the room.
